Output f2666ea23c30f6f95ca139d074211e4f783c2ba9da722d18c4a19ffa4c36c70a:3

value
382950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8502da4c8d1f67b98e4ad4d8dbf46fbf49aec6c2 OP_EQUAL
address
3DpKDGX8msyctr4XpBmGRmQkQUCCo3yHRD
transaction
f2666ea23c30f6f95ca139d074211e4f783c2ba9da722d18c4a19ffa4c36c70a
spent
true